Analytic App date selector - Incorrect dates picked up

Kieran
7 - Meteor

Hello,

 

I have an issue with a workflow published to our Alteryx Gallery. It's set up to take FROM and TO dates as parameters but for some reason when I run it from the gallery, it minuses 1 day from each of the dates.

I've stripped down the workflow and attached it. In the example below, I selected May 15th to May 19th. When I ran the flow, it emails me the selected dates, which came back as May 14th to May 18th.

@Kieran I've temporarily placed a modified version of @SeanAdams app in the public alteryx gallery. When I select 5/22/2017 as the from date and 5/23/2017 as to the to date, it spits out those dates as I expect. I'm trying to slim this down and remove as many possible hiccups as possible. Here's my suggestion:

 

1) Go to the app: https://gallery.alteryx.com/#!app/AnalyticAppDatesv2/59315735a18e9e0240641a96.

2) Open "Inspect" (F12 in chrome).

3) Run the app and choose May 22 and May 23.

4) Open the resulting csv in notepad (not excel).

5) See if the csv has the correct dates for newfromdate and newtodate.

6a) If it looks ok, then download the app and repeat steps 1-5 in your private server to see if that makes a difference.

6b) If it doesn't look ok in the public gallery or private gallery, then look at your inspect >>network tab to see what data was passed to the alteryx server. Here is what mine looks like (notice the request payload at the bottom has the correct dates).

@Kieran This is a fascinating find. I think that this is a bug you should report to support@alteryx.com. 

 

For what it's worth, I was able to replicate your issue if I changed my computer's time zone to Ireland and then used IE. Using Chrome, even with my fake Ireland time zone, seemed to produce the correct answer though. I wonder if it works backwards, where you could change your time zone to the US and then it would produce the correct results in IE.

Hi All

 

Thanks for the outputs and feedback.  I can confirm we are able to replicate this issue on our latest Server version and we will be escalating internally to find the root cause.  As a workaround please use Chrome instead of IE.  However, if you must use IE from your client then you can change your Date Time Zone to match the Server Time Zone and this should generate the correct results.
